What is a deflection?
Deflection drags a defender away from its duty. By capturing, checking or threatening, you force an enemy piece to abandon the square, line or piece it was guarding, then exploit what it left behind.
How to spot it
Identify which enemy piece holds the position together — the guard of a mating square, a back rank or a loose piece. Any forcing move that attacks that overworked guard is a deflection candidate.
What this set trains
Deflection sets build the habit of asking “what is this piece defending?” before every exchange — a question that exposes hidden wins constantly.
